Transaction 32c6eb0109e7560a9aa120834aec0e8063293187a112900ad38d89e791f34d8b
1 Input
1 Output
-
32c6eb0109e7560a9aa120834aec0e8063293187a112900ad38d89e791f34d8b:0
- value
- 1875387
- script pubkey
- OP_0 OP_PUSHBYTES_20 555225953dfedd84b3f09add52199866bc8f18ea
- address
- bc1q24fzt9falmwcfvlsntw4yxvcv67g7x82vz66tc